Preparing to Pack Like a Pro: The Foundation
Before you even think about pulling out a suitcase, the first step to packing like a pro involves strategic planning. Skipping this crucial phase is the most common packing mistake!
Researching Your Trip Like a Pro
What’s the destination? What will the weather be like? What activities are planned? Knowing these details helps tailor your packing list precisely. A beach holiday requires different items than a mountain trek or a business trip. Check the forecast close to your departure date.
Choosing the Right Luggage for Packing Like a Pro
Your choice of bag dictates how much you can bring. Are you aiming for carry-on only (the ultimate light packing challenge)? Or do you need checked luggage? Ensure your bag meets airline size and weight restrictions. Invest in quality, lightweight luggage if you travel often – it makes a difference when you’re aiming for efficient packing.

The Essential Packing List for Packing Like a Pro
This is where the rubber meets the road. Building your packing list is key to packing like a pro. Think in categories and be ruthless about what makes the cut. Ask yourself: “Do I really need this?” and “Can this item serve multiple purposes?”
Curating Your Packing List Like a Pro
Start with the absolute necessities and build from there. Here’s a breakdown:
- Clothing: Focus on versatile items that can be mixed and matched. Layers are your friend! Pack for the number of days you’re gone, but consider washing clothes on longer trips.
- Tops (mix of short/long sleeve)
- Bottoms (versatile trousers, shorts, skirts)
- Outerwear (jacket, sweater depending on climate)
- Underwear & Socks (pack enough for each day, plus a couple extra)
- Sleepwear
- Swimwear (if applicable)
- One slightly dressier outfit (just in case)
- Footwear: Limit yourself to 2-3 pairs: comfortable walking shoes, maybe sandals or dress shoes depending on the trip. Wear your bulkiest pair while traveling.
- Toiletries: Travel-size is king! Only bring what you absolutely need.
- Shampoo, Conditioner, Soap/Body Wash
- Toothbrush & Toothpaste
- Deodorant
- Skincare essentials
- Hairbrush/comb & hair ties
- Any personal hygiene items
- Health & Safety: Don’t overlook this crucial part of packing like a pro.
- Any prescription medications (with copies of prescriptions)
- Basic first-aid kit (band-aids, antiseptic wipes, pain relievers)
- Hand sanitizer
- Motion sickness remedies (if needed)
- Documents & Money: Keep these safe and accessible.
- Passport/ID & Visas
- Flight/Train/Accommodation confirmations (digital or printed)
- Credit/Debit Cards & some local currency
- Emergency contact information
- Travel insurance details
- Electronics: We can’t live without them, but pack smart.
- Phone & Charger
- Portable Power Bank
- Travel Adapter/Converter (check your destination’s plug type!)
- Headphones
- Camera & extra memory card/battery (if not using phone)
- Miscellaneous Must-Haves for Packing Like a Pro:
- Reusable water bottle
- Book or e-reader
- Small backpack or day bag
- Sunglasses & Hat
- Travel pillow & eye mask
Must-Have Travel Essentials for Packing Like a Pro
These items might not be on every standard list but are invaluable for efficient packing and a smooth trip:
- Packing Cubes: Game-changers for organizing packing and compressing clothes.
- Laundry Bag: Keep dirty clothes separate.
- Dry Bag/Waterproof Pouch: Protect electronics or important documents.
- Small Lock: For hostel lockers or luggage.

Packing Techniques of the Pros: How to Fit It All
Having the list is one thing; making it fit is another! Mastering packing techniques is fundamental to packing like a pro.
Mastering Packing Techniques for Packing Like a Pro
- Roll, Don’t Fold: Rolling clothes minimizes wrinkles and saves space, especially for t-shirts, pants, and socks.
- Use Packing Cubes: I can’t stress this enough. Packing cubes compartmentalize your items, compress air, and make it easy to find things without rummaging. This is key for organized packing.
- Fill Empty Spaces: Stuff socks and underwear into shoes. Tuck smaller items into corners.
- Heaviest Items Near Wheels (Checked Bag): If checking a bag, put heavier items at the bottom, near the wheels, so they don’t crush lighter items when the bag is upright.
- Keep Essentials Accessible: Anything you need during transit (documents, snacks, medication, entertainment) should be in your personal item or easily accessible pocket in your carry-on.

Packing Like a Pro for Different Trip Types
While the core list is a great starting point, packing like a pro means adapting to your specific journey.
Tailoring Your Packing List Like a Pro
- Business Trip: Focus on wrinkle-resistant professional attire. Bring a garment bag if needed.
- Beach Holiday: More swimwear, sunscreen, a sun hat, casual wear. Fewer layers.
- Adventure Travel: Specific gear like hiking boots, moisture-wicking clothing, maybe camping equipment. Focus on durability.
- Cold Weather: Thermal layers, heavy coat, gloves, hat, waterproof boots. These are bulky, so wear as much as possible while traveling.
Trip-Specific Packing Tips for Packing Like a Pro
Always check if your accommodation provides amenities like hairdryers or towels – saves space! For international travel, research cultural norms regarding dress.

The Pro’s Final Packing Check
You’ve packed everything, used smart techniques, and your bag mostly closes. What’s the final step in packing like a pro? A thorough review.
Finalizing Your Packing Like a Pro
- Weigh Your Bag: Use a luggage scale to avoid surprises at the airport counter.
- Double-Check Documents: Passport, tickets, bookings – are they accessible and safe?
- Review Your List: Quickly scan your original packing list to ensure nothing vital was forgotten.
- Consider Security: Don’t pack prohibited items. Make sure liquids are compliant with regulations.
